Cleaning Food Contact Surfaces

What are food contact surfaces?


(1) A surface of equipment or a utensil with which
food normally comes into contact; or
(2) A surface of equipment or a utensil from which
food may drain, drip, or splash:
(a) Into a food, or
(b) Onto a surface normally in contact with food.

Food Contact Surfaces
When to clean?
Always clean:

BEFORE use of utensils, equipment, tables, etc


BETWEEN USE especially when preparing raw animal
foods like eggs, fish, meat, poultry
AFTER USE
ANYTIME you suspect contamination
Lets define Clean
What does it mean to clean?
Remove all food, crumbs, and dirt
Clean BEFORE sanitizing

Lets define Sanitize
What does it mean to
sanitize?
Kill harmful germs with
high heat or chemical
solution

What does it mean to


disinfect?
To kill harmful germs
Stronger than sanitizing
solution
How to Clean
1.Remove food particles from surface
using a brush, pad or towel
How to Clean
2. Wash/Rinse the Surface with a clean, soapy
cloth or towel.
How to Clean
3. Sanitize the Surface using correct sanitizing solution.
Make sure the whole contact surface came in contact with
sanitizing solution.
How to Clean
4. Let surface Air Dry.
